No you aren't, you just seem to believe that the people who came up with
the PRA algorithm have come up with something that doesn't require lots of
forwarders to change their software. This is not the case.

Not to mention mailing lists.  Something like 20% of the mailing lists
mirrored to Usenet on gmane.org do not add the Sender: header and will
have to be changed in order for the Caller-ID PRA algorithm to work.
From what I can tell, this is a *MUCH* larger issue than the whole
forwarding issue.  While MicroSoft folks (Jim Lyon and Harry Katz)
have repeatedly claimed that the SPF breaks more stuff, I have a hard
time believing it, especially with *zero* published data to back up
their claim.
